HFL100

Course Code(s): HFL100

Pre-Requisite: None

Course Description: Students will gain practical knowledge about mental, emotional, physical, and sexual health in this course. Among the topics studied are mental health awareness, violence & bullying, communication skills, healthy coping techniques, nutrition, human sexuality, and substance abuse. Additionally, students complete a research project on a disease of their choice. There are several guest speakers who come into class to share their expertise. Students will become certified in First Aid & CPR at the end of the course.

Work Load: Group, individual, projects. Little to no homework.

Why You Might Be Interested In The Class: Students who want a more hands-on teacher-guided experience covering vital life skills. Image Health also has a number of engaging guest speakers and little to no homework. Much of the coursework is done during the school day.
